Factors Affecting *Lethal Company Player Count*
Several factors can influence the *Lethal Company Player Count*. Understanding these factors can help players and developers anticipate changes in the game's popularity and community size.
- Game Updates and Patches: Regular updates and patches can significantly impact the player count. New content, bug fixes, and balance changes can attract new players and retain existing ones.
- Marketing and Promotion: Effective marketing and promotional campaigns can boost the player count by increasing the game's visibility and attracting new players.
- Community Engagement: Active community engagement through forums, social media, and events can foster a sense of belonging and encourage players to stay engaged.
- Competition: The release of new games or updates to competing titles can affect the *Lethal Company Player Count*. Players may switch to other games if they find them more appealing or engaging.
